Job Description

Req ID : 2441424
  • Read and interpret blueprints to determine layout of system components
  • Perform preparatory construction work including steel work wiring and piping
  • Install elevators escalators moving walkways dumbwaiters and related equipment according to specifications
  • Connect car frames to counterweights with cables and assemble elevator cars
  • Install and wire electric and electronic control system devices
  • Install test and adjust safety control devices
  • Test operation of newly installed equipment
  • Troubleshoot electrical or mechanical systems failures
  • Disassemble defective units and repair or replace worn or suspect parts
  • Adjust valves ratchets seals brake linings and other components
  • Carry out preventative maintenance programs to ensure public safety.

Elevator constructors and mechanics may specialize in construction maintenance or repair.



Requirements

  • Completion of secondary school is usually required.
  • Completion of a four to fiveyear apprenticeship program
    or
    A combination of over four years of work experience in the trade and some high school college or industry courses in elevator construction or repair is usually required to be eligible for trade certification.
  • Elevator constructor and mechanic trade certification is compulsory in Quebec and Alberta and available but voluntary in British Columbia the Northwest Territories and Nunavut.
